The SurgeArrest Home/Office P8GT 8-Outlets Surge Suppressor provides a high level of protection for your computers, electronics and connected devices, as well as providing surge protection for your phone lines. Its state of the art circuitry offers excellent protection for sensitive electronic equipment against large surges and multiple surge events.

I've been using this for a month and it seems to work. My cable box is in the Always on outlet, my TV is in the Master outlet, and my DVD player is in the Slave outlet controlled by the master. When I turn my TV off the DVD player shuts completely off to save power. However, I don't know how much power and money I'm saving. I like the look and feel of the APC P8GT because it is wider than most protectors with plenty of room for plugs.
I wish it had an On/Off switch when I want to turn off all the devices plugged in. Also, sometimes when I turn my TV on or off there seems to be a power surge because all the lights on my DVD player turn on brightly temporarily. This is worrisome because the APC device is supposed to prevent surges, not create them.
